| NOTE: For Superdome and other nPartition-able servers, you
must use the boot device path "path flags" to set automatic booting
past the BCH for a nPartition. See the manual HP System
Partitions Guide for more information, including the
proper configuration of paths for a nPartition. When booting multiple virtual partitions automatically, the
sequence for booting is not deterministic, and booting a sequence
of virtual partitions automatically is not supported. If booting
a sequence is required, the sequence of virtual partitions needs
to be booted manually (one by one). For more information on booting
a virtual partition, see “Booting
a Virtual Partition”. When booting multiple virtual partitions automatically, there
is no way to tell which virtual partition will be active with the
console after the partitions have booted. All changes to stable storage can only be performed at the BCH> prompt. See “System-wide
stable storage and the setboot command”. If you need to reboot the hard partition as part of the process
to access the BCH>, see “Shutting
Down or Rebooting the Hard Partition (rebooting the vPars monitor)”. For information on accessing and using the BCH commands, please
see your hardware manual. |
